What are 3 major differences between prokaryotic and eukaryotic cells?

Prokaryotic

  1. These cells do not have a well defined nucleus
  2. They are mostly unicellular
  3. Present in bacteria, algae and other microbes

Eukaryotic

  1. These cells have a well-defined nucleus
  2. They are mostly multi-cellular
  3. Present in humans, plants, animals
